A New Direction for the Fallout Series
Fallout 76 is a departure from the traditional Fallout formula, which typically focuses on a strong single-player narrative. Instead, the game is designed as a multiplayer experience, with players able to join forces and explore the post-apocalyptic world of Appalachia. While this change may have been a departure from the series’ roots, it’s not necessarily a bad thing. In fact, the game’s multiplayer aspects can add a new layer of depth and replayability to the game.

The Cons of Playing Fallout 76 Solo
Of course, there are also some cons to consider:
- Limited Endgame Content: The game’s endgame content is limited, with few options for players to continue playing once they’ve completed the main story.
- Repetitive Gameplay: The game’s gameplay can become repetitive, with players completing the same quests and activities over and over again.
- Lack of Human NPCs: The game’s lack of human NPCs can make the world feel empty and desolate, which can be a turn-off for some players.
